Is it possible to directly open a file with Google Doc

For now, on Mac, there is an option "View on dropbox.com". I'm wondering if there is any workaround such that I can directly open docx files with Google Doc. 

I understand that I can create GDocs on dropbox, but I do not want to deal with the access permission issues, and I just want to edit the file with GDoc rather than creating a GDoc file.

I have tried to play around with the url, but it didn't work.

 

Any help / idea is appreciated.
